Here is the definition of the word “Refraction”:

**Refraction**: (noun) The bending or changing of the direction of a light beam or other wave as it passes from one medium to another, where the media have different optical properties, such as density or composition. This can occur when light passes from air into water, glass, or other materials.

For example: “The refraction of light through a prism allows us to see a rainbow of colors.”

In other contexts, refraction can also refer to the bending or deformation of sound waves or other types of energy as they pass through different materials or media.
